Job Description

Job Description

Summary :

Educate, counsel, and support students in the career development process for students before and during job search in the U.S. job market. These duties encompass a wide range of responsibilities that ensure the smooth operation of a university career center and support the career development of students.

Job Responsibilities :

Support Career Development Programs :

  • Support the development and delivery of career strategies courses, providing students with essential job search skills through interactive workshops, presentations, and personalized guidance.
  • Conduct Training or Assist in implementing career development programs, providing students with essential job search skills through interactive workshops, presentations, and career strategies classes to develop employability skills for students in professional job search topics.
  • Offer creative feedback for ongoing development of course materials. Assist with instructional design for modules or courses.

Support Students :

  • Provide personalized 1 : 1 career coaching session to students, offering tailored advice and resources to support their professional development and job search strategies.
  • Conduct mock interviews, review resumes and cover letters and coach students about job search techniques.
  • Provide professional referral services for any student requiring extended treatment for social, personal, or psychiatric problems.
  • Support Events and Meetings : Assist in organizing and supporting events and meetings held by the Career Center including webinars, employer visits and visitor weekends.

    Maintain Records :

  • Keep accurate records of student and employer information related to internships and work-study.
  • Perform data entry tasks such as final interview scores and annual rollup (MBA)
  • Use and Manage Office Equipment : Effectively use and manage office equipment such as phones, faxes, and copiers to meet office needs.
  • Special Projects :

    Some additional duties might include working on Special Projects of Career Services and Career Development including but not limited to Resume, Market Research or Applications for streamlining Job Search for MIU students including Handshake or similar tools.

    Perform other Office administrative duties as assigned.
